본 고안은 편향요크용 세퍼레이터에 관한 것이다.The present invention relates to a separator for deflection yoke.

편향요크는 음극선관의 네그측에 장착되어 전자총에서 주사되는 비임을 편향시켜 화면 상에 화소가 형성되게하는 부품이다.The deflection yoke is a component mounted on the four sides of the cathode ray tube to deflect the beam scanned by the electron gun so that pixels are formed on the screen.

이 편형요크는 음극선관의 네크측에 장착되기 위하여 세퍼레이터 상에 고정부착되어지는데 세퍼레이터는 음극석관의 펀넬측 외표면과 밀착될 수 있게 전체로서 나팔모양의 형태로 제조되는 것이 일반적이다.The flat yoke is fixedly mounted on the separator to be mounted on the neck side of the cathode ray tube, and the separator is generally manufactured in the shape of a trumpet as a whole so as to be in close contact with the outer surface of the funnel side of the cathode stone tube.

그런데 나팔형테는 사출성형이 불가능하므로 이를 반으로 분해형성한 다음 1쌍을 합체시켜서 하나의 편향요크용 세퍼레이터를 만들고 있다.However, trumpet frames are not injection molded, so they are decomposed in half and then merged into a pair to make a separator for one deflection yoke.

따라서 세퍼레이터를 구성하는 반나팔체는 상호 견고하게 연결되기 위한 결합수단을 필요로 하게 되고, 이를 위하여 종래에는 빗장과 같이 만들어진 결합수단을 세퍼레이터에 부사시키고 있다.Therefore, the semi-trumpet body constituting the separator needs a coupling means to be firmly connected to each other, and for this purpose, conventionally, the coupling means made as a latch is attached to the separator.

보다 상세히 설명하면, 일측의 반나팔체에 화살촉 모양의 그립퍼를 돌출형성하고 대응하는 타측 반나팔체로는 전기한 그립퍼가 끼워져 결합될 수 있는 계지홈을 부가시켜서 양 구조물의 결합에 의해 1쌍의 반나팔체가 하나의 세퍼레이터로 구성되게 하고 있다.In more detail, an arrowhead-shaped gripper is formed to protrude from one half of the trumpet body, and the other half of the trumpet body adds a locking groove to which the above gripper is fitted to be coupled to each other, thereby combining one pair of the two halves. The bugle is made up of one separator.

이러한 결합수단은 극도로 정교한 금형기술을 요구하는 것이므로 제조하기가 쉽지 않고, 또 반나팔체의 조립작업에서 그립퍼 혹은 계지홈이 쉽게 파손되는 일이 빈번하여 폐기율이 높다는 결점이 있다.Since the coupling means requires extremely sophisticated mold technology, it is not easy to manufacture, and there is a drawback that the gripper or the locking groove is frequently broken during the assembly work of the semi-trumpet body, and the disposal rate is high.

게다가 종래의 세퍼레이터는 그 내외주면에 장착되는 수직 및 수평코일의 인출선을 처리할 방도가 없어서 배선을 정돈하기 어렵게 되어 있는 결점이 있다.In addition, the conventional separator has a drawback that it is difficult to arrange the wiring because there is no way to handle the lead lines of the vertical and horizontal coils mounted on the inner and outer circumferential surfaces thereof.

본 고안의 목적은 상술한 종래의 세퍼레이터에 있어서 반나팔체의 결합수단을 개선함과 동시에 수직 및 수평 코일의 인출선을 간결하게 처리할 수 있는 편향요크용 세퍼레이터를 제공함에 있다.An object of the present invention is to provide a deflection yoke separator capable of concisely processing lead wires of vertical and horizontal coils while improving the coupling means of the half-trumpet body in the aforementioned conventional separator.

이에 따라 본 고안은 상호 합체되는 1쌍의 반나팔체에 있어서, 일측 반나팔체 상에 괘지훅을 형성하고, 이에 대응하는 타측 반나팔체로는 전기한 괘지훅이 걸려지는 걸림돌기를 부가시켜서 양 반나팔체가 합체될 수 있게 함과 동시에 외주 상방으로 전서 도출공이 형성되도록 구성함을 특징으로 한다.Accordingly, the present invention, in a pair of half bugle to be merged with each other, to form a hook hook on one side of the half bugle body, and to the other half bugle body corresponding to the other half by adding the hooking protrusion to hang the hooked hook hook It is characterized in that it is configured to allow the trumpet body to be coalesced and at the same time, to form a jeonseo derivation hole outward.

제1도는 좌우 1쌍의 반나팔체(2a)(2b)에 의해 형성되는 세퍼레이터의 측면도이다.1 is a side view of a separator formed by a pair of left and right half trumpets 2a and 2b.

본 고안에 관련된 세퍼레이터는 양 반나팔체(2a)(2b)가 합체되는 부위에서 도면의 A부분으로 표시되는 부위와, B부분으로 표시되는 부위에 각각 특유의 결합수단을 보유하고 있다.The separator according to the present invention has its own coupling means, respectively, at the site indicated by part A and the site indicated by part B at the site where both halves (2a) and (2b) are incorporated.

즉 A부분은 제2도 (a)에 도시한 바와 같이, 일측 반나팔체(2a)가 선단이 갈고리상을 이루는 훅크부재(4)를 보유하고 있으며, 이에 대응하는 타측 반나팔체(2b)는 훅크부재(4)의 선단과 맞물려지는 걸림돌기(6)를 보유하고 있다.That is, the portion A has a hook member 4 having a hooked end thereof on one side of the half trumpet body 2a as shown in FIG. 2 (a), and the other half trumpet body 2b corresponding thereto. Has a locking projection 6 engaged with the tip of the hook member 4.

한편, 걸림돌기(6)는 훅크부재(4)와의 계합시에 그 작동이 원활히 이루어지도록 전면측이 경사면을 이루고 있다.On the other hand, the engaging projection 6 has an inclined surface on the front side so as to smoothly operate when engaging the hook member (4).

그리고 양 반나팔체(2a)(2b)는 네크 홀더(8)의 하측에 형성된 마그네트설치판(10)의 바로 일부분 외주로 절결구(12)를 형성하여 합체시에상의 전선인출공이 형성되게 하고 있다.And both half trumpets (2a) (2b) forms a notch 12 to the outer periphery of the magnet mounting plate 10 formed on the lower side of the neck holder (8) at the time of coalescence The wire lead-out hole on the top is formed.

일측 반나팔체(2a)에서 전기한 훅크부재(4)와 절결구(12) 사이에는 계합홈(13a)이 형성되어 있고, 타측 반나팔체(2b)에서 전기한 게합홈(13a)에 대응하는 위치에는 플럭(13b)이 돌출 형성되어 있다.An engagement groove 13a is formed between the hook member 4 and the cutout hole 12 that are posted by one half trumpet body 2a and correspond to the matching groove 13a that is tucked away by the other half trumpet body 2b. The floc 13b is protruded in the position to make.

또한 B부분은 제2도 (b)에 도시한 바와 같이, 수상관의 펀넬측 외표면에 맞접촉되는 플랜지(14)의 상면에서 코어싱이트(16)와 나란히 일측 반나팔체(2a)에는 걸림돌기(6)가 형성되어 있고, 이에 대응하여 타측 반나팔체(2b)에는 훅크부재(4)가 부가되어 있다.Further, as shown in FIG. 2 (b), the portion B has one side half trumpet body 2a parallel to the core piece 16 on the upper surface of the flange 14 which is in contact with the outer surface of the funnel side of the water pipe. A hooking protrusion 6 is formed in the hook, and a hook member 4 is added to the other half trumpet body 2b.

여기서도 플랜지(14)의 접촉단에 전기한 계합홈(13a), 플럭(13b)과 동일한 형태로서 일측 반나팔체(2a)에 플럭(13c)이, 그리고 타측 반나팔체(2b)로 계합홈(13d)이 각각 형성되어 있다.Here, the same shape as that of the engaging groove 13a and the floc 13b, which are provided at the contact end of the flange 14, the floc 13c in one half flap body 2a and the engaging groove in the other half flap body 2b. 13d are formed, respectively.

물론 제2도 (a)의 훅크부재(3), 걸림돌기(6)과 제2도 (b)의 훅크부재(4), 걸림돌기(6)는 형태와 기능이 대동소이한 것이고 단지 설치위치상의 차이가 있을 뿐이다.Of course, the hook member 3, the locking projection 6 of FIG. 2 (a) and the hook member 4, the locking projection 6 of FIG. There is only a difference.

이와 같이 구성되는 본 고안에 의하면, 양 반나팔체(2a)(2b)는 각각 상하측에 형성된 훅크부재(4)와 걸림돌기(6) 사이의 계합에 의해 상호 일체로 결합되어 하나의 세퍼레이터를 형성케 되는 것이고, 이들 훅크부재(4)와 결합돌기(6)의 계합시에 훅크부재(4)의 선단은 걸림돌기(6)가 보유하는 경사면을 타고 진행하여 맞물려지기 때문에 훅크부재(4)는 잘못 가해지는 외력에 대해서 다소의 적응성을 갖게 되어 쉽게 부러지는 일이 없게 된다.According to the present invention constituted as described above, the two half trumpets 2a and 2b are integrally coupled to each other by an engagement between the hook members 4 and the locking protrusions 6 formed on the upper and lower sides, respectively, to form one separator. When the hook member 4 and the engaging projection 6 are engaged with each other, the tip of the hook member 4 proceeds on the inclined surface held by the locking projection 6 to be engaged with the hook member 4. Has some adaptability to wrongly applied external force, so that it is not easily broken.

그리고 본 고안의 세퍼레이터는 마그네트설치판의 하측에 형성된 절결구에 의하여 전선인출공이 형성되어지므로 장착되는 코일의 양단을 이 전선인출공으로 도출하여 외부회로와 접속시킴에 따라 배선의 정리를 간편하게 할 수 있는 이점도 나타내는 한편, 반나팔체의 상하측에 형성된 계합홈과 플럭간의 결합에 의해 반나팔체의 축방향 조합이 한층 정확하게 되어 세퍼레이터형상의 정밀도를 향상시킬 수 있는 장점도 갖추고 있는 것이다.In the separator of the present invention, the wire drawing hole is formed by the cutout formed in the lower side of the magnet mounting plate, so that both ends of the mounted coil can be led to the wire drawing hole and connected with an external circuit to simplify the arrangement of the wiring. On the other hand, the axial combination of the half-trumpet body is more precise by the engagement between the engagement grooves and the flocks formed on the upper and lower sides of the half-trumpet body, which also has the advantage of improving the accuracy of the separator shape.
